Abstract: A segment of cut-and-cover tunnel is parallel to the existing Nanning-Guangzhou high speed rail which is under construction. The distance from the edge of the track to the edge of the excavation is 20.5 meters. It is concluded that impact of the cutandcover tunnel construction on the existing high speed rail should be evaluated. The safety evaluation criteria are established from the various design codes and existing construction practice. A typical section that represented the worst case scenario (distance between the excavation and the rail track, large excavation depth and unfavorable subsurface conditions) was selected for the finite element analysis. The influence of the active and inactive rail track on the cut-and-cover tunnel excavation were simulated.
